The nasal block could be due to a sinus infection, a cold or a chronic allergy. It could also be due to a deviated nasal septum or nasal polyps. Sinus infection causes blockage of flow especially when a person lies down. The blockade is affected by the side to which the person turns also. You will need to consult your primary care physician for proper assessment. In the meantime practice good breathing exercises, humidify your room and do steam inhalations.

One of the nostrils is always constricted, in a normally functioning nose, but it usually switches back and forth from left to right side. Maybe it's more noticeable because of your operation, but you might want to see an ENT again to make sure something else isn't going on.
